Commit Graph

10471 Commits

Author SHA1 Message Date
Nick Dimiduk 9ae023fcab HBASE-13149 HBase MR is broken on Hadoop 2.5+ Yarn (Jerry He) 2015-04-26 12:09:44 -07:00
Elliott Clark 4d6dc38a70 HBASE-13339 Update default Hadoop version to 2.6.0 2015-04-26 11:40:30 -07:00
Andrew Purtell cd83d39fb4 HBASE-13550 [Shell] Support unset of a list of table attributes 2015-04-24 17:51:19 -07:00
tedyu 8a18cf3c01 HBASE-13555 StackServlet produces 500 error 2015-04-24 16:40:32 -07:00
stack 0415649f3d HBASE-13552 ChoreService shutdown message could be more informative (Jonathan Lawlor) 2015-04-24 13:42:03 -07:00
Srikanth Srungarapu b5fb861f76 HBASE-13536 Cleanup the handlers that are no longer being used. 2015-04-24 12:25:25 -07:00
Josh Elser e09b28941f HBASE-13554 Clarify release versioning policy.
HBase is not following the strictness of SemVer, so
make sure we correctly advertise this. Document the
edge-case where APIs may be added in patch-releases.

Signed-off-by: Sean Busbey <busbey@apache.org>
2015-04-24 13:49:15 -05:00
Sean Busbey 9eecd43013 HBASE-13546 handle nulls in MasterAddressTracker when there is no master active. 2015-04-24 13:49:15 -05:00
stack 4c97d4b244 HBASE-13523 API Doumentation formatting is broken (Dylan Jones) 2015-04-24 08:06:20 -07:00
ramkrishna 40a80c1fe0 HBASE-13450 - Addendum to remove an Unused import 2015-04-24 16:13:54 +05:30
ramkrishna a4fa930843 HBASE-13450 - Purge RawBytescomparator from the writers and readers for
HBASE-10800 (Ram)
2015-04-24 16:01:38 +05:30
tedyu e1cb405adc HBASE-13528 A bug on selecting compaction pool (Shuaifeng Zhou) 2015-04-24 02:16:41 -07:00
Matteo Bertozzi ad2b1d8467 HBASE-13529 Procedure v2 - WAL Improvements 2015-04-24 09:24:29 +01:00
Apekshit(Appy) Sharma 031dd3638c HBASE-13534 Changed Master UI to promptly display if it is a backup master. (Apekshit)
Signed-off-by: Elliott Clark <eclark@apache.org>
2015-04-23 15:06:53 -07:00
ramkrishna bcb2a279c4 HBASE-13501 - Deprecate/Remove getComparator() in HRegionInfo. (Ram) 2015-04-23 12:12:36 +05:30
anoopsjohn a4202879ad HBASE-13496 Make Bytes::compareTo inlineable. 2015-04-23 10:36:08 +05:30
Jerry He 6c427175b8 HBASE-13526 TestRegionServerReportForDuty can be flaky: hang or timeout 2015-04-22 21:19:10 -07:00
Jonathan Lawlor afd7a8f474 HBASE-13527 The default value for hbase.client.scanner.max.result.size is never actually set on Scans
Signed-off-by: stack <stack@apache.org>
2015-04-22 13:29:18 -07:00
tedyu 2bf8cda4f6 HBASE-13437 ThriftServer leaks ZooKeeper connections (Winger Pun) 2015-04-22 07:52:23 -07:00
ramkrishna 2396020752 HBASE-13502 - Deprecate/remove getRowComparator() in TableName (Ram) 2015-04-22 09:24:00 +05:30
Elliott Clark 07b8a7b264 HBASE-13524 TestReplicationAdmin fails on JDK 1.8 2015-04-21 17:06:10 -07:00
zhangduo fe9180d79e HBASE-13499 AsyncRpcClient test cases failure in powerpc 2015-04-14 23:00:07 +08:00
Rajesh Nishtala 0b4e32a206 HBASE-13471 Fix a possible infinite loop in doMiniBatchMutation
Summary: in doMiniBatchMutation it is possible to get into an infinite loop when a query has a row that is not in the region. If the batch had an invalid row, the row lock further down the function would fail to acquire because it was an invalid row. However we'd catch the exception and improperly treat it as if we had not acquired the lock and then try acquiring the lock again. Thus once we got into this state we'd be stuck in an infinite loop. Worse yet, this infiite loop would occur with the readLock held. So any other opertaions such as doClose() would be locked out and stuck. The patch is to check whether the row is valid and short circuit the failure when it doesn't work.

Test Plan: IntegrationTestReplication would consistently fail when trying to disable large tables before the fix. After the test the tests pass consistently.

Reviewers: eclark

Subscribers: asameet

Differential Revision: https://reviews.facebook.net/D37437

Signed-off-by: Elliott Clark <eclark@apache.org>
2015-04-21 15:24:52 -07:00
stack 91ab1086d6 HBASE-13078 Removal of IntegrationTestSendTraceRequests (Josh Elser) 2015-04-21 12:45:25 -07:00
Enis Soztutar 4e0de088c5 HBASE-13515 Handle FileNotFoundException in region replica replay for flush/compaction events 2015-04-21 11:55:35 -07:00
anoopsjohn 2ba4c4eb9f HBASE-13520 NullPointerException in TagRewriteCell.(Josh Elser) 2015-04-21 17:34:09 +05:30
tedyu eb82b8b309 HBASE-13514 Fix test failures in TestScannerHeartbeatMessages caused by incorrect setting of hbase.rpc.timeout (Jonathan Lawlor) 2015-04-20 14:48:10 -07:00
Sean Busbey 702aea5b38 HBASE-13498 Add more docs and a basic check for storage policy handling. 2015-04-20 10:45:14 -05:00
Devaraj Das 3bf69761e1 HBASE-13482. Phoenix is failing to scan tables on secure environments. (Alicia Shu) 2015-04-19 22:17:38 -07:00
tedyu 3baab26d0b HBASE-13481 Addendum sets MASTER_HOSTNAME_KEY config 2015-04-19 15:16:21 -07:00
Tobi Vollebregt 176261af78 HBASE-13430 HFiles that are in use by a table cloned from a snapshot may be deleted when that snapshot is deleted
Signed-off-by: Matteo Bertozzi <matteo.bertozzi@cloudera.com>
2015-04-18 09:48:08 +01:00
Matteo Bertozzi b7abdd61c9 HBASE-13202 Procedure v2 - core framework (addendum) 2015-04-18 09:46:14 +01:00
Enis Soztutar 92e922e11d HBASE-13491 Issue in FuzzyRowFilter#getNextForFuzzyRule (Anoop Sam John) 2015-04-17 21:54:41 -07:00
Enis Soztutar 66e55ff388 HBASE-13481 Master should respect master (old) DNS/bind related configurations 2015-04-17 18:11:26 -07:00
Jonathan Lawlor abe3796a99 HBASE-13090 Progress heartbeats for long running scanners
Signed-off-by: stack <stack@apache.org>
2015-04-17 15:42:46 -07:00
Elliott Clark 2c5dc53a32 HBASE-13477 Create metrics on failed requests
Summary: Add metrics on how many requests are exceptions and what type.

Test Plan: behold unit tests.

Differential Revision: https://reviews.facebook.net/D37167
2015-04-17 15:37:31 -07:00
Jerry He 3ccae37866 HBASE-13456 Improve HFilePrettyPrinter first hbase:meta region processing (Samir Ahmic) 2015-04-17 11:29:33 -07:00
stack 0dfeba3d78 HBASE-13487 Doc KEEP_DELETED_CELLS 2015-04-17 08:27:45 -07:00
stack 92af695ea1 HBASE-13307 Making methods under ScannerV2#next inlineable, faster 2015-04-17 08:15:07 -07:00
tedyu bcc5e1b353 HBASE-13486 region_status.rb broken with NameError: uninitialized constant IOException (Samir Ahmic) 2015-04-17 06:38:46 -07:00
Nick Dimiduk 7fb6055ed7 add branch-1.1 to precommit build list 2015-04-16 17:45:47 -07:00
tedyu e08ef99e30 HBASE-13473 deleted cells come back alive after the stripe compaction (jeongmin kim) 2015-04-16 11:36:25 -07:00
Matt Warhaftig ddab4726f6 HBASE-13350 Log warnings for sanity check failures when checks disabled.
Signed-off-by: Matteo Bertozzi <matteo.bertozzi@cloudera.com>
2015-04-16 09:51:47 +01:00
Josh Elser 682a29a57f HBASE-12987 Pare repeated hbck output and increase verbosity in long-running tasks. 2015-04-15 14:35:43 -07:00
Devaraj Das 14261bc9e5 HBASE-13453. Master should not bind to region server ports (Srikanth Srungarapu) 2015-04-15 11:02:08 -07:00
Andrew Purtell 2da1bf10b8 HBASE-12006 [JDK 8] KeyStoreTestUtil#generateCertificate fails due to "subject class type invalid"
This is a port of the fix from HADOOP-10847
2015-04-15 09:47:34 -07:00
Devaraj Das d314f7d9e0 HBASE-13460. Revise the MetaLookupPool executor-related defaults (introduced in HBASE-13036). 2015-04-15 07:56:25 -07:00
tedyu d6926629f9 HBASE-13475 Small spelling mistake in region_mover#isSuccessfulScan causes NoMethodError (Victor Xu) 2015-04-15 05:05:37 -07:00
Matteo Bertozzi 4788c6d1a8 HBASE-13455 Procedure V2 - master truncate table 2015-04-15 10:35:41 +01:00
Matteo Bertozzi d75326a797 HBASE-13202 Procedure v2 - core framework (addendum) 2015-04-15 09:50:47 +01:00